In 1856, Margaret Kelsey entered the world in Charleston, Elizabethtown-Kitley, Leeds and Grenville, Ontario, Canada, born to Benjamin Kelsey And Jane Ann Spicer. Margaret Kelsey married George W Sterry. Margaret Kelsey passed away in 1882 in Lyndhurst, Leeds and the Thousand Islands, Leeds and Grenville, Ontario, Canada.
